Abstract

See full text

The present invention provides a charge/discharge measuring apparatus capable of appropriate charge/discharge management by accurately measuring a capacitance change of a secondary battery in charge/discharge. This charge/discharge measuring apparatus is configured such that a current from the secondary battery can be switched between a first connection circuit in which the secondary battery, a load resistor, and a conductor film are connected in series and a second connection circuit in which the secondary battery, a charger, and the conductor film are connected in series. Moreover, this charge/discharge measuring apparatus has a magnetic film arranged in parallel with the conductor film and connected in parallel with connection from the secondary battery to the load resistor and the charger and has a voltage detecting means for detecting a voltage change in the magnetic film.
